What is Sales and Marketing?
Sales and marketing are two closely related fields that are essential for the success of any business. Sales involves the process of selling products or services to customers, while marketing focuses on promoting and creating awareness about those products or services. Both functions work together to drive revenue and growth for a company.
In sales, professionals build relationships with customers, identify their needs, and provide solutions that meet those needs. This involves effective communication, negotiation, and persuasion skills. Marketing professionals, on the other hand, utilize various strategies and channels to reach target audiences and create demand for the products or services. This can include advertising, social media marketing, content creation, and more.
The History and Myth of Sales and Marketing
Sales and marketing have been around for centuries, although the approaches and strategies have evolved over time. In ancient times, merchants would travel long distances to sell their goods, relying on their persuasive skills to convince buyers. As societies developed, marketing techniques became more sophisticated, with the advent of print advertising, radio, and eventually, digital marketing.
There is a common myth that sales and marketing are all about manipulation and trickery. However, this is far from the truth. In today's world, successful sales and marketing professionals focus on building trust and providing value to customers. The goal is to understand customer needs and offer solutions that genuinely benefit them. By doing so, companies can establish long-term relationships and drive customer loyalty.

Q&A About Starting a Career in Sales and Marketing
Q: What skills are important for a career in sales and marketing?
A: Strong communication, interpersonal, and problem-solving skills are essential for success in sales and marketing. Additionally, creativity, analytical thinking, and the ability to work well in a team are highly valued.
Q: Is a degree necessary for a career in sales and marketing?
A: While a degree in marketing or a related field can provide a strong foundation of knowledge, it is not always necessary. Practical experience, skills, and a willingness to learn can often outweigh formal education.
Q: How can I stand out in a competitive job market?
A: To stand out in a competitive job market, focus on building a strong personal brand. Showcase your skills, experience, and achievements through your resume, portfolio, and online presence. Additionally, networking and making connections in the industry can help open doors to new opportunities.
Q: What are the career prospects in sales and marketing?
A: Sales and marketing offer a wide range of career opportunities, from entry-level roles to management positions. With the increasing importance of digital marketing, there is a growing demand for professionals with expertise in areas such as social media marketing, content creation, and data analytics.
